154 static void intel_lvds_pps_get_hw_state(stru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v,
155 					struct intel_lvds_pps *pps)
156 {
157 	u32 val;
158 
159 	pps->powerdown_on_reset = I915_READ(PP_CONTROL(0)) & PANEL_POWER_RESET;
160 
161 	val = I915_READ(PP_ON_DELAYS(0));
162 	pps->port =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_PORT_SELECT_MASK, val);
163 	pps->t1_t2 =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_POWER_UP_DELAY_MASK, val);
164 	pps->t5 =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_LIGHT_ON_DELAY_MASK, val);
165 
166 	val = I915_READ(PP_OFF_DELAYS(0));
167 	pps->t3 =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_POWER_DOWN_DELAY_MASK, val);
168 	pps->tx =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_LIGHT_OFF_DELAY_MASK, val);
169 
170 	val = I915_READ(PP_DIVISOR(0));
171 	pps->divider = REG_FIELD_GET(PP_REFERENCE_DIVIDER_MASK, val);
172 	val = REG_FIELD_GET(PANEL_POWER_CYCLE_DELAY_MASK, val);
173 	/*
174 	 * Remove the BSpec specified +1 (100ms) offset that accounts for a
175 	 * too short power-cycle delay due to the asynchronous programming of
176 	 * the register.
177 	 */
178 	if (val)
179 		val--;
180 	/* Convert from 100ms to 100us units */
181 	pps->t4 = val * 1000;
182 
183 	if (INTEL_GEN(dev_priv) <= 4 &&
184 	    pps->t1_t2 == 0 && pps->t5 == 0 && pps->t3 == 0 && pps->tx == 0) {
185 		DRM_DEBUG_KMS("Panel power timings uninitialized, "
186 			      "setting defaults\n");
187 		/* Set T2 to 40ms and T5 to 200ms in 100 usec units */
188 		pps->t1_t2 = 40 * 10;
189 		pps->t5 = 200 * 10;
190 		/* Set T3 to 35ms and Tx to 200ms in 100 usec units */
191 		pps->t3 = 35 * 10;
192 		pps->tx = 200 * 10;
193 	}
194 
195 	DRM_DEBUG_DRIVER("LVDS PPS:t1+t2 %d t3 %d t4 %d t5 %d tx %d "
196 			 "divider %d port %d powerdown_on_reset %d\n",
197 			 pps->t1_t2, pps->t3, pps->t4, pps->t5, pps->tx,
198 			 pps->divider, pps->port, pps->powerdown_on_reset);
199 }

227 static void intel_pre_enable_lvds(struct intel_encoder *encoder,
228 				  const struct intel_crtc_state *pipe_config,
229 				  const struct drm_connector_state *conn_state)
230 {
231 	struct intel_lvds_encoder *lvds_encoder = to_lvds_encoder(&encoder->base);
232 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= to_i915(encoder->base.dev);
233 	struct intel_crtc *crtc = to_intel_crtc(pipe_config->base.crtc);
234 	const struct drm_display_mode *adjusted_mode = &pipe_config->base.adjusted_mode;
235 	int pipe = crtc->pipe;
236 	u32 temp;
237 
238 	if (HAS_PCH_SPLIT(dev_priv)) {
239 		assert_fdi_rx_pll_disabled(dev_priv, pipe);
240 		assert_shared_dpll_disabled(dev_priv,
241 					    pipe_config->shared_dpll);
242 	} else {
243 		assert_pll_disabled(dev_priv, pipe);
244 	}
245 
246 	intel_lvds_pps_init_hw(dev_priv, &lvds_encoder->init_pps);
247 
248 	temp = lvds_encoder->init_lvds_val;
249 	temp |= LVDS_PORT_EN | LVDS_A0A2_CLKA_POWER_UP;
250 
251 	if (HAS_PCH_CPT(dev_priv)) {
252 		temp &= ~LVDS_PIPE_SEL_MASK_CPT;
253 		temp |= LVDS_PIPE_SEL_CPT(pipe);
254 	} else {
255 		temp &= ~LVDS_PIPE_SEL_MASK;
256 		temp |= LVDS_PIPE_SEL(pipe);
257 	}
258 
259 	/* set the corresponsding LVDS_BORDER bit */
260 	temp &= ~LVDS_BORDER_ENABLE;
261 	temp |= pipe_config->gmch_pfit.lvds_border_bits;
262 
263 	/*
264 	 * Set the B0-B3 data pairs corresponding to whether we're going to
265 	 * set the DPLLs for dual-channel mode or not.
266 	 */
267 	if (lvds_encoder->is_dual_link)
268 		temp |= LVDS_B0B3_POWER_UP | LVDS_CLKB_POWER_UP;
269 	else
270 		temp &= ~(LVDS_B0B3_POWER_UP | LVDS_CLKB_POWER_UP);
271 
272 	/*
273 	 * It would be nice to set 24 vs 18-bit mode (LVDS_A3_POWER_UP)
274 	 * appropriately here, but we need to look more thoroughly into how
275 	 * panels behave in the two modes. For now, let's just maintain the
276 	 * value we got from the BIOS.
277 	 */
278 	temp &= ~LVDS_A3_POWER_MASK;
279 	temp |= lvds_encoder->a3_power;
280 
281 	/*
282 	 * Set the dithering flag on LVDS as needed, note that there is no
283 	 * special lvds dither control bit on pch-split platforms, dithering is
284 	 * only controlled through the PIPECONF reg.
285 	 */
286 	if (IS_GEN(dev_priv, 4)) {
287 		/*
288 		 * Bspec wording suggests that LVDS port dithering only exists
289 		 * for 18bpp panels.
290 		 */
291 		if (pipe_config->dither && pipe_config->pipe_bpp == 18)
292 			temp |= LVDS_ENABLE_DITHER;
293 		else
294 			temp &= ~LVDS_ENABLE_DITHER;
295 	}
296 	temp &= ~(LVDS_HSYNC_POLARITY | LVDS_VSYNC_POLARITY);
297 	if (adjusted_mode->flags & DRM_MODE_FLAG_NHSYNC)
298 		temp |= LVDS_HSYNC_POLARITY;
299 	if (adjusted_mode->flags & DRM_MODE_FLAG_NVSYNC)
300 		temp |= LVDS_VSYNC_POLARITY;
301 
302 	I915_WRITE(lvds_encoder->reg, temp);
303 }

773 static bool compute_is_dual_link_lvds(struct intel_lvds_encoder *lvds_encoder)
774 {
775 	struct drm_device *dev = lvds_encoder->base.base.dev;
776 	unsigned int val;
777 	struct drm_i915_private *dev_priv = to_i915(dev);
778 
779 	/* use the module option value if specified */
780 	if (i915_modparams.lvds_channel_mode > 0)
781 		return i915_modparams.lvds_channel_mode == 2;
782 
783 	/* single channel LVDS is limited to 112 MHz */
784 	if (lvds_encoder->attached_connector->panel.fixed_mode->clock > 112999)
785 		return true;
786 
787 	if (dmi_check_system(intel_dual_link_lvds))
788 		return true;
789 
790 	/*
791 	 * BIOS should set the proper LVDS register value at boot, but
792 	 * in reality, it doesn't set the value when the lid is closed;
793 	 * we need to check "the value to be set" in VBT when LVDS
794 	 * register is uninitialized.
795 	 */
796 	val = I915_READ(lvds_encoder->reg);
797 	if (HAS_PCH_CPT(dev_priv))
798 		val &= ~(LVDS_DETECTED | LVDS_PIPE_SEL_MASK_CPT);
799 	else
800 		val &= ~(LVDS_DETECTED | LVDS_PIPE_SEL_MASK);
801 	if (val == 0)
802 		val = dev_priv->vbt.bios_lvds_val;
803 
804 	return (val & LVDS_CLKB_POWER_MASK) == LVDS_CLKB_POWER_UP;
805 }
